    The Beach is a store that looks like a uppity gifts store sans gifts. What you are left with are…read moremass produced items of furniture that are cheap replicas of modern antiques. Simply raise the prices threefold and tell people that all New Zealand beach houses look like this and you have yourself a store. In reality, New Zealand baches are full of musty, outdated and badly matched furniture from decades ago. The Beach is the inside of an interior design magazine like House and Garden. Most of the wicker baskets and beach chairs are not going to survive in a closed up, damp beach house. The best thing to do in this shop is take note of the designs and colours you like and replicate it via your nearest Salvation Army furniture, some sand paper and a lick of paint.
